Medical Definition of Hypocupraemia

1. Reduced copper content of the blood; found in Wilson's disease because ceruloplasmin is depressed, even though serum albumin-attached copper is increased. Origin: hypo-+ L. Cuprum, copper, + G. Haima, blood (05 Mar 2000)
